LyondellBasell and Sinopec JV to manufacture propylene oxide and styrene monomer
LyondellBasell, one of the largest plastics, chemicals and refining companies in the world and the China Petroleum & Chemical Corporation (Sinopec), one of the largest integrated energy companies in China, today announced the signing of an agreement to form a 50:50 joint venture (JV) which will produce propylene oxide (PO) and styrene monomer (SM) in China's domestic market. First announced on December 23, 2019, the JV will operate under the name Ningbo ZRCC LyondellBasell New Material Company Limited.

The JV will construct a new PO and SM unit in Zhenhai Ningbo, China. This new unit will have 275 kilotons per annum (KTA) capacity of PO and 600 KTA capacity of SM. The unit will use LyondellBasell's leading PO / SM technology. Products produced by the JV will be marketed equally by both partners, significantly expanding their respective participation in the Chinese market for PO and SM. Startup is expected at the end of 2021.
The formation of the JV is subject to approvals by relevant government authorities, including antitrust review by the State Administration for Market Regulation. LyondellBasell expects to make its equity contribution to the JV during the first quarter of 2021.
According to IHS Markit, China accounts for more than 60 percent of chemical market demand in Asia and represents 40 percent of global chemical market growth over the next decade. PO and SM are core products of LyondellBasell and are used in a variety of applications including packaging, building and construction, furnishings and transportation.
LyondellBasell operates five wholly-owned facilities in China which are located in Guangzhou, Suzhou, Dalian, Dongguan and Changshu.
